The terms to be consisted of in any work contract will certainly vary relying on a number of variables, including the precise nature of the work to be carried out and the jurisdictions governing the contract - Trademark Lawyer. That claimed, the following arrangements are normally necessary for an enforceable and protective arrangement. Range of Services. The nature of the job the service provider is performing need to be plainly mentioned in the contract.
Independent Professional Standing. One of one of the most important terms to include is a declaration (or paragraph) detailing that the individual is not a staff member of the company and is, rather, an independent professional. The service provider is not entitled to company benefits, and considering that a service provider is taken into consideration a freelance person, they are in charge of any type of and all tax obligations (such as earnings, Social Security, and Medicare) as a result of the specialist standing.
The arrangement needs to note payment terms and exactly how much the specialist will be paid to perform the solutions. Will the contractor require the business to pay for any type of expenditures, such as travel or products?
The term should likewise be led to out: is it for an uncertain amount of time (till terminated), a short initial period (perhaps one month), and/or does the agreement instantly renew? Things first: what is an independent service provider contract? An independent service provider agreement is a lawfully binding record signed by a 1099 worker and the firm that hires them. It outlines the range of work and the terms under which that function will certainly be finished, which goes a long means to seeing to it both events get on the very same web page concerning the task from the beginning.
That method, the agreement employee can't return later on and claim they didn't obtain specific advantages that are because of employees. The independent service provider contract is a vital device in making this distinction and guaranteeing the lines in between freelancers and full-time employee don't end up being obscured. Lastly, the agreement lays out assumptions for both events, like the timeline on which the work will be finished and exactly how the specialist will certainly be paid, as well as mapping a course to what activities will certainly be taken must any disagreements occur.

This is the component of the agreement that we discussed a moment agothe one that specifies that the employee is an independent specialist and not a staff member of the company.
You should make clear in this area that the employee is in charge of covering their very own taxesthe business will certainly not keep any kind of taxes on their behalf as it would from the paycheck of a full-time staff member. Depending on the kind of services the specialist is providing, you might intend to use this section to require that they show proof of obligation insurance coverage.
This ought to be the simplest part of the independent contractor contract for you to produce; it's the component where you lay out the deliverables you're anticipating to obtain from the contractor in exchange for payment. The deliverable will certainly differ relying on the job being done, however it ought to specify, as an example, the specialist will certainly supply one 30-second radio business advertising Acme Company using a downloadable add-on in mp3 layout.
In many cases, like one where you're hiring an advertising expert to evaluate in on a brand-new project, there could not be a concrete deliverable. Generating the deliverable could be part of the job itself. In this situation, you ought to detail what objectives the project is implied to complete.
In enhancement to laying out the deliverables that are anticipated, your contractor arrangement must define the timeline for the work to be done: when you expect the last deliverable in addition to any kind of key due dates along the method. If your task calls for signoffs from multiple parties, be sure to take those right into consideration when setting the timeline.
